Transaction 39c5e21f8b58de1a84b4cf73af5523b19de8ad0227779a75390b1e5a3a412068
1 Input
1 Output
-
39c5e21f8b58de1a84b4cf73af5523b19de8ad0227779a75390b1e5a3a412068:0
- value
- 30195814
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c49519786357427461df6e0e44be426533c029a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M5mVUe7gG3eYRdMRGHXNK1RzjRaAQ7Q2G